Kirtland Community College facts and stats
Kirtland Community College enrolls about 1,905 undergraduate students. Kirtland is located in a rural campus setting. The student-to-faculty ratio is 17:1.
Grayling, MI

What you'll actually pay
Kirtland’s in-state tuition is $6,450, while out-of-state tuition is $8,970. About 21% of students receive aid, with an average merit award of $1,214.

At Kirtland Community College, out-of-state tuition is $8,970, compared with $6,450 for in-state tuition. About 21% of students receive financial aid, with an average aid package of $10,541, which can substantially reduce the amount billed for eligible students. Merit awards average $1,214, so students should plan around need-based aid and personal costs as well.
